| Obverse description | Central field bears four large Chinese ideograms arranged vertically in two columns, reading top to bottom and right to left, giving the denomination and monetary designation. Manchu script characters appear prominently above the central inscription, while additional Chinese ideograms encircle the periphery of the field, recording the reign title, cyclical date (Dingwei, year 33 of Guangxu), and the issuing authority. The overall layout is characteristic of late Qing machine-struck copper cash coinage, with the legends arranged in a formal, symmetrical composition without a central boss or decorative border motif. |
